Position Overview

You've got an eye for the leading edge of technology and can identify potential in the latest innovations on the market to move your projects and department forward. Better yet, you know how to realize your vision and can establish detailed and intentional project plans while remaining agile to ensure your innovative initiatives go off without a hitch. With your passion for sustainability and energy efficiency, you'd be a great fit as our Conservation and Energy Management (C&EM) Project Specialist for Deep Energy Retrofits in existing buildings.

Supporting the award-winning Innovative Technology program within our C&EM department, you'll assist in shaping the future of natural gas by designing and executing innovative research and pilot activities while collaborating with our internal and external stakeholders.

You know how to build solid business cases, highlighting the opportunity and feasibility of new technologies to provide grounding to the solutions you identify. When taking on projects, you're proactive approaches help you get ahead of potential challenges as you tackle situations head-on with creative solutions to ensure they stay on track.

In this role, you will:

  • Develop rapport and effective working relationships with internal and external stakeholders, including our procurement and legal teams, municipalities and industry associations.
  • Expand your knowledge and understanding of the latest in Demand Side Management (DSM) technology solutions, the characteristics of our customer base and our strategic vision.
  • Identify, prioritize and advance new innovative technology solutions that have a significant opportunity to reduce natural gas consumption, and develop project business cases.
  • Work with various departments to execute project deliverables that may include requests for proposals, legal agreements and privacy and audit requirements.
  • Prioritize the development cycle and effectively execute initiatives to increase participation, customer satisfaction and streamline operations.
  • Become an industry expert by developing extensive networks with our market actors and driving the adoption of DSM innovative technologies.
  • Target inefficiencies to improve the execution of current and future projects.
  • Identify new natural gas DSM technologies and lead its advancement in the market.

What it takes:

  • A diploma in a related discipline, such as business, plus a minimum of three years of relevant experience with demonstrated success.
  • A Project Management Professional or Certified Energy Manager designation is considered an asset.
  • Previous experience with delivering and communicating DSM programs and experience working in a regulated utility would be an asset.
  • A proven track record in designing and delivering successful multi-stakeholder projects on time, budget and within scope.
  • Exceptional organizational, technical and analytical skills to support with measurement and verification activities and reporting.
  • A demonstrated ability to manage a team and to work independently to successfully execute projects.

In this role, you will have the option to participate in a flexible work program, enabling you to work from an approved flex location in British Columbia up to 85 days a year (equivalent to approximately two days a week), subject to business or operational needs.
